[edit] Biography

Born on March 18, 1926 in Detroit, Michigan, Dick Littlefield (Richard Bernard Littlefield) played for the Boston Red Sox, Chicago White Sox, St. Louis Browns, Detroit Tigers, Pittsburgh Pirates, Baltimore Orioles, St. Louis Cardinals, New York Giants, Chicago Cubs and Milwaukee Braves over the course of his 9 year career. Littlefield broke into the bigs on July 7, 1950 with the Boston Red Sox, and put up a 3.54 ERA in 94 innings pitched in 1952, his rookie year.

There is some disagreement on what was Dick Littlefield's most productive season. Some believe that it was 1954, when he posted a 3.86 ERA, won 10 games and struck out 97 batters. However, others believe that it was 1956, when he posted a 4.37 ERA and struck out 80 batters.

[edit] Transactions

  • Signed as an amateur free agent by Boston Red Sox (1946).
  • Traded by Boston Red Sox with Al Zarilla and Joe Dobson to Chicago White Sox in exchange for Bill Wight and Ray Scarborough (December 10, 1950).
  • Traded by Chicago White Sox with Joe DeMaestri, Gus Niarhos, Gordon Goldsberry and Jim Rivera to St. Louis Browns in exchange for Al Widmar, Sherm Lollar and Tom Upton (November 27, 1951).
  • Traded by St. Louis Browns with Ben Taylor, Cliff Mapes and Matt Batts to Detroit Tigers in exchange for Gene Bearden, Bob Cain and Dick Kryhoski (February 14, 1952).
  • Traded by Detroit Tigers with Marlin Stuart, Don Lenhardt and Vic Wertz to St. Louis Browns in exchange for Jim Delsing, Ned Garver, Dave Madison and Bud Black (August 14, 1952).
  • Traded by Baltimore Orioles to Pittsburgh Pirates in exchange for Cal Abrams (May 25, 1954).
  • Traded by Pittsburgh Pirates with Bobby Del Greco to St. Louis Cardinals in exchange for Bill Virdon (May 17, 1956).
  • Traded by St. Louis Cardinals with Jackie Brandt, Red Schoendienst, Bill Sarni and a player to be named later to New York Giants in exchange for Al Dark, Ray Katt, Don Liddle and Whitey Lockman (June 14, 1956); New York Giants received Gordon Jones (October 1, 1956).
  • Traded by New York Giants with $30000 to Brooklyn Dodgers in exchange for Jackie Robinson (December 13, 1956); Jackie Robinson refused to report to New York Giants; trade voided (December 13, 1956).
  • Traded by New York Giants with Bob Lennon to Chicago Cubs in exchange for Ray Jablonski and Ray Katt (April 16, 1957).
  • Sold by Chicago Cubs to Milwaukee Braves (March 30, 1958).
